Nottingham Forest boss Nuno Espirito Santo has been speaking to the media before Saturday’s Premier League game at Fulham (15:00 GMT).
Here are the key lines from his news conference:
On whether Forest have enough strength in depth to maintain their European hopes: “When things happen then we have to find solutions. Regarding the depth of our squad, I think we have solutions. It would be better if we maintain healthy and everybody available. I think we can compete in both competitions until the end of the season. But, we don’t operate on ifs. The reality is I think we have balance and a good squad.”
Despite Forest’s positive position in the table, Nuno is not looking beyond the next game and did not comment on the push for the top four: “We have to enjoy it. The players are enjoying working together and competing. We are looking forward to the match – nothing changes.”
Taiwo Awoniyi broke his nose in Tuesday’s FA Cup win over Exeter, with Nuno stating: “He is with the medical department and waiting for the right protocols to be followed. We have to wait and see if he is available. With concussion we have to be really careful. He is OK – he is smiling.”
Callum Hudson-Odoi is “progressing”, trained yesterday and today and will be assessed before Saturday. Nuno said he is “positive” about the winger’s chances of making the trip to London.
On the penalty shootout win against Exeter in the FA Cup: “We have been recovering the players who due to overtime put in a big effort. We are trying to get them back to normal. It was very important for us to achieve what we went there to do. We did it in a hard way but I think we dealt with it well. Exeter were really good so I am glad.”
On Saturday’s opponents: “Fulham is a very good team – we have to be ready for a tough match. [They have a] good manager. It will be a new game that we have to be ready for. Marco [Silva] has quality and energy all over the place.”
On talks over a new deal for defender Ola Aina: “Things are going well. I am positive and confident everything will be solved.”
On warm weather training in Dubai last week: “It felt good. We worked intense and had good training sessions. At the same time, we had time to be together off the pitch. That enforces the players make this tight bond between themselves. It was good for us to go.”
